Output 3e989164ab110a2d2124950287205d579ec9c53ce701044a63c581ed20f1aab9:12

value
3119
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dbe8a94dc851fdfa51a0b0fdc27f656e4111f387eec2fcb0a879a9f10766e6e0
address
bc1pm052jnwg287l55dqkr7uylm9deq3ruu8amp0ev9g0x5lzpmxumsqehan9r
transaction
3e989164ab110a2d2124950287205d579ec9c53ce701044a63c581ed20f1aab9
spent
true